Temporary Acting Role Promotion Letter
A Temporary Acting Role Promotion Letter is a formal document confirming an employee's interim appointment to a higher-level position. It must clearly outline the temporary duration of the assignment and any associated salary adjustments or stipends. Key elements include specific responsibilities, reporting structures, and the expected end date or conditions for returning to the original role. This letter ensures legal clarity and operational continuity, protecting both the employer and staff member by defining performance expectations and compensation terms during the transition period.

Relocation and Role Promotion Letter
A Relocation and Role Promotion Letter is a formal document confirming a career advancement tied to a geographic move. It must clearly outline your new job title, updated salary, and the specific effective date of the transition. Crucially, the letter should detail the relocation package, including moving stipends or housing assistance. This document serves as a legal record of your professional growth and corporate commitment. Ensure you review all contractual obligations and repayment clauses before signing to secure your career progression and financial stability during the transition.
What is a standard promotion letter?
A standard promotion letter is an official document issued by an employer to notify an employee of their advancement to a higher position, detailing their new title, responsibilities, and updated compensation package.
What key information should be included in a promotion letter?
The letter should include the new job title, the effective start date of the role, the updated salary or wage, reporting structure changes, and any new benefits or bonuses associated with the position.
Is a promotion letter a legally binding contract?
While often treated as an amendment to an existing employment agreement, a promotion letter serves as a formal record of new terms; however, it should clearly state if it supersedes previous contracts or if specific clauses remain in effect.
How should an employee respond to a formal promotion letter?
An employee should respond with a professional acceptance email or signed copy of the letter, expressing gratitude and confirming their understanding of the new duties and start date.
Why is it important to provide a written promotion letter instead of a verbal offer?
A written letter ensures clarity, prevents future disputes regarding pay or job expectations, and provides the necessary documentation for HR and payroll departments to update employee records.
